Output 848500108babfd32608ff98e82030bd33acb65af081007025ef2ee9a48d69b1c:0

value
552002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9673007dea86e2ecf5a99b4f3f9af16782d17263 OP_EQUAL
address
3FQX3ntBV6NNuJdroSBzd4gkg4nJdjYhzc
transaction
848500108babfd32608ff98e82030bd33acb65af081007025ef2ee9a48d69b1c
spent
true